Saved
Upon the mighty surface of the rising torrid sea
I spoke with God, my savior, who waited there for me
He told me of my virtues and sent me on my way
My time was not this moment, but on another day
I felt as if the rising sun had leapt within my heart
Filling me with hope and light, a brand new day to start
I swam back to the waiting shore and crawled on to the sand
Knowing, in this morning sun, that God had saved this man
I wept until the tears had dried, what seemed to be all day
Rising then unto my knees, for a moment just to pray
“Oh mighty God in Heaven I am humbled by your love.
You come to me upon this earth, yet exist in all above.
A servant, I, am to the word, that spreads the truth of You
With hopes, that all will see the Lord, in everything I do.
My God, I’m oh so sorry for living here with doubt
You’ve proved me, true, a sinner that has now turned about
My dying days and living life are forever to be spent
By teaching of your valued words and all they’ve ever meant”
Upon this very day, this day of my new birth
I promise to spread the Word to all I meet on earth
